Mobile Legends: Bang Bang (MLBB), commonly referred to simply as Mobile Legends (ML), is a mult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) game developed and published by Moonton, a subsidiary of Savvy Games Group. The Mobile Legends: Bang Bang World Championship is the annual professional Mobile Legends: Bang Bang world esports championship tournament for the game wherein teams worldwide would be facing off each other to become the world champion for Mobile Legends: Bang Bang. The yearly tournament is presented by Moonton and has been held seven times.
Mobile Legends: Bang Bang Mid Season Cup, referred to as MSC, is an annual international tournament for professional esport teams for the MOBA game Mobile Legends: Bang Bang hosted by Moonton during the halfway point of each year split since 2017.
The Mobile Legends: Bang Bang Women's International and formerly known as Mobile Legends: Bang Bang Women's Invitational is an annual world championship series for the female professional leagues of the Mult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) mobile game Mobile Legends: Bang Bang.
